International Congress on Targeted Anticancer Therapies (TAT 2013)

The International Congress on Targeted Anticancer Therapies (TAT) is dedicated to targeted agents for the treatment of cancer and includes topics such as:

  • Clinical development on approved targeted agents for cancer therapy
  • Agents with a cancer-specific molecular target with a focus on early-phase clinical development agents
  • Methodological and regulatory issues in anticancer drug development
  • Early-phase clinical trials and translational research

The International Congress on Targeted Anticancer Therapies (TAT) brings together delegates from industry, academia and governmental agencies with an interest in the development of innovative cancer therapies.
